Bruce A. Buckingham is a scholar working on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Surgery and Genet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Bruce A. Buckingham has authored 270 papers receiving a total of 10.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 238 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, 172 papers in Surgery and 145 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Bruce A. Buckingham's work include Diabetes Management and Research (226 papers), Pancreatic function and diabetes (162 papers) and Diabetes and associated disorders (139 papers). Bruce A. Buckingham is often cited by papers focused on Diabetes Management and Research (226 papers), Pancreatic function and diabetes (162 papers) and Diabetes and associated disorders (139 papers). Bruce A. Buckingham coll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and Israel. Bruce A. Buckingham's co-authors include Darrell M. Wilson, Stuart A. Weinzimer, Roy W. Beck, David M. Maahs, William V. Tamborlane, B. Wayne Bequette, Gregory P. Forlenza, Craig Kollman, Fraser Cameron and Katrina J. Ruedy and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Journal of Clinical Investigation and S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ología.
